范围和内容
Minutes and committee papers of the Finance and General Purposes Committee for the meetings held on 29/09/1970, 12/01/1971, 20/04/1971, 13/07/1971, 13/10/1971, 17/01/1972, 10/07/1972, 11/10/1972. All minutes signed by F Walter Oakley, Chairman of the committee.
Matters arising 29/09/1970: problems of the directorate of PCL; premises at 204 Albany Street - St Katherine's House; Publican's alcohol licences at Marylebone Road and New Cavendish Street; the future of the Polytechnic Magazine; Chiswick Boathouse - rebuilding the training tank; compassionate fund; financial statement; powers and functions of the committee.
Matters arising 12/01/1971: title of professor; sabatical officers; rooms at rear of 5 Cavendish Square; Architectural Review feature; role of senior pro-directors.
Matters arising 20/04/1971: posts of pro-directors; report from Academic Council; fees for 1971/1972; Computer Centre - New Cavendish Building; adaptations to Little Titchfield Street.
Matters arising 13/07/1971: posts of pro-directors; professoriate; Annual Saussure Lecture in Linguistics; Academic report; Regional Centre for Management Education; Bolsover Street Hall of Residence; Halls of Residence charges; report from Members' Liaison Committee; Constitution of Teaching Staff Association of the PCL; Department of Photography Film [sic] - Distribution in France; Little Titchfield Street premises adaptations; forms of indemnity; Ethel Wood bequest for Chapel or quiet room.
Matters arising 13/10/1971: Posts of pro-directors; professoriate; residual responsibility: report of the Academic Council; Application for Maintenance Grant; report from Members' Liaison Committee; adapations to Little Titchfield Street; 74 Great Portland Street; FSSU - Parallel Arrangements; Deed of Variation; banking facilities; compassionate fund.
Matters arising 10/01/1972: Pro-directors: professoriate; Regional Centre of Management Education; accommodation problems at PCL; report of the Academic Council; advisory committees; future of St Katherine's House; student discipline; refectory prices; Board of Architectural Education members; Extra Mural Centre.
Matters arising 10/07/1972: Regional Centre for Management Education; advisory committees; report of the Academic Council; report of the activities of the TSA; report of the Student Services Committee; part-time fees; short-term loan investments; Quintin Hogg Memorial Scholarships; FSSU parallel arrangements.
Matters arising 04/10/1972: pro-directors; Regional Centre for Management Education; Accommodation problems of PCL; development plan; adaptations to Little Titchfield Street; probation procedure; report from the Academic Council; Report of the Student Services Committee; report from the Members' Liaison Committee; FSSU Parallel Arrangements; London Electricity Board; Compassionate Fund.
